首页
学习
活动
专区
圈层
工具
发布
社区首页 >专栏 >BUUCTF [安洵杯 2019]easy misc 1

BUUCTF [安洵杯 2019]easy misc 1

作者头像
YueXuan
发布2025-08-18 20:15:42
发布2025-08-18 20:15:42
2320
举报

题目描述:

得到的 flag 请包上 flag{} 提交。

密文:

下载附件,解压得到

在这里插入图片描述
在这里插入图片描述

解题思路:

1、使用Bandzip打开decode.zip文件,得到关于密码的提示。(当时我真没想到这跟压缩包密码有关系)

在这里插入图片描述
在这里插入图片描述
计算步骤
计算根号内的值
\sqrt{2524921} = 1589
进行乘法和除法
1589 \times 85 = 135065
135065 \div 5 = 27013
加法
27013 + 2 = 27015
再次进行除法
27015 \div 15 = 1801
减法
1801 - 1794 = 7
字符串拼接
7 + "NNULLULL,"

猜测7位数字加上字符串"NNULLULL," 构成密码,使用ARCHPR进行掩码爆破,得到密码如下:

代码语言:javascript
复制
2019456NNULLULL,
在这里插入图片描述
在这里插入图片描述

解压decode.zip文件,得到如下内容

代码语言:javascript
复制
a = dIW
b = sSD
c = adE 
d = jVf
e = QW8
f = SA=
g = jBt
h = 5RE
i = tRQ
j = SPA
k = 8DS
l = XiE
m = S8S
n = MkF
o = T9p
p = PS5
q = E/S
r = -sd
s = SQW
t = obW
u = /WS
v = SD9
w = cw=
x = ASD
y = FTa
z = AE7

2、使用binwalk查看小姐姐.png,发现还有一张图片。(我的binwalk为什么会出问题,然后一不小心恢复快照,只能再装一个Kali了)

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

用foremost提取图片,结果是两张一样的图片。

在这里插入图片描述
在这里插入图片描述

猜测为盲水印,使用BlindWaterMark工具,解密得到如下内容:

在这里插入图片描述
在这里插入图片描述

3、对11.txt进行字频统计,字符按照出现频率从大到小排列如下:

代码语言:javascript
复制
大->小:
字符: etaonrhisdluygwmfc. ,bp"k'Hv-ITS?ADMRWPGN!FxBOYjCEzqLQUV;K:J)(134Z0792X5*~86	\

根据hint.txt的提示hint:取前16个字符,取其前16个字符: etaonrhisdluygw。(第一位是空格)

代码语言:javascript
复制
# 定义映射规则
mapping = {
    'a': 'dIW',
    'b': 'sSD',
    'c': 'adE',
    'd': 'jVf',
    'e': 'QW8',
    'f': 'SA=',
    'g': 'jBt',
    'h': '5RE',
    'i': 'tRQ',
    'j': 'SPA',
    'k': '8DS',
    'l': 'XiE',
    'm': 'S8S',
    'n': 'MkF',
    'o': 'T9p',
    'p': 'PS5',
    'q': 'E/S',
    'r': '-sd',
    's': 'SQW',
    't': 'obW',
    'u': '/WS',
    'v': 'SD9',
    'w': 'cw=',
    'x': 'ASD',
    'y': 'FTa',
    'z': 'AE7'
}

# 需要映射的字符串
input_str = "etaonrhisdluygw"

# 进行映射
result = ''.join(mapping[char] for char in input_str)

# 打印结果
print(result)

根据先前得到的decode.txt中的映射规则,得到字符串QW8obWdIWT9pMkF-sd5REtRQSQQWjVfXiE/WSFTajBtcw=,在这一步出现与官方WP不同的地方。

最后没有问题会得到flag:flag{have_a_good_day1}

flag:

代码语言:javascript
复制
flag{have_a_good_day1}
本文参与 腾讯云自媒体同步曝光计划,分享自作者个人站点/博客。
原始发表:2025-08-18,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 题目描述:
  • 密文:
  • 解题思路:
    • 计算步骤
      • 计算根号内的值
      • 进行乘法和除法
      • 加法
      • 再次进行除法
      • 减法
      • 字符串拼接
  • flag:
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档